We will climb the highest point in Mexico City, Cruz del Marqués Peak in the Cumbres del Ajusco National Park, a volcano less than 30 km south of this megapolis downtown with more than 20 million inhabitants.

Ajusco in Nahuatl means forest in the water, due to the presence of springs with forests. The conifers of Ajusco are essential for aquifer recharge. Recurrent rains are captured by the volcanic soil that recharges the underground rivers of the country's capital.

This volcano is ideal for practicing trekking.
